 MUSIC | String fling Saturday, Mar. 31, at Sangamon Auditorium, UIS, guest conductor Andrew Sewell, Wisconsin Chamber Orchestra music director, leads the Illinois Symphony Orchestra in a concert of swashbuckling overtures, brilliant symphonies and the beautiful Brahms Violin Concerto featuring extraordinary world-renown violinist, Vadim Gluzman. Gluzman is an Israeli violinist who appears regularly around the world with major orchestras. Sewell has led orchestras around the world from Toronto to Mexico, Japan and Hong Kong. Concert Comments with these two impressive artists starts at 7 p.m. and is hosted by WUIS radio personality Karl Scroggin.
